牙髓或根尖周组织疾病 / Diseases of pulp or periapical tissues

Definitions

Dental pulp is that part of the tooth located in the center of the coronal portion underneath dentin and composed of connective tissue, blood vessels and nerve endings. Periapical tissues are designated as those located at the tip of the tooth root surrounding the apical foramen.
